- In business, the term "concession" can have different meanings depending on the context. Here are some possible meanings of the term:
- A concession agreement is a contract that gives a company the right to operate a specific business within a government's jurisdiction or on another firm's property, subject to particular terms1.
- A concession is a type of discount that is offered as a compromise or negotiation between two parties. It is a reduction in the price of a product or service that is given to a customer as a form of goodwill or compensation2.
- Concession can also refer to official permission to carry out a particular type of business, or to own or do work on a particular piece of property or land, given by a government or company3.
- In some cases, concession can refer to permission to sell something, especially in part of a store owned by someone else, or a business that sells something4.
